Why do eggs stick to my non-stick pan?

It is therefore not surprising that the eggs stick to the bottom of the pan. As the egg cooks, its proteins form chemical bonds with the metal in the pan. The non-stick coating prevents this sticking, as well as the addition of fats such as oil or butter to the pan in front of the eggs.

Do you turn the eggs when you fry them?

Sunny side up: Fry the egg with the yolk side up and do not flip it. Easy: The egg turns and the yolk is still liquid. Above the middle: the egg is overturned and the yolk is only slightly runny. Good: The egg is turned over and the yolk is hard-boiled.
